East Coast - north of Cape St. Francis

Forecast

Marine Forecast

Issued 03:00 AM NDT 18 April 2024

Today Tonight and Friday.

Gale warning in effect.

Wind northwest 25 knots and locally gusts to 35 along the coast. Wind becoming north 35 this morning with gusts to 45 along the coast tonight and Friday morning. Wind becoming north 25 to 35 Friday afternoon then diminishing to north 20 Friday evening.

Rain becoming snow or rain this afternoon then rain this evening and ending Friday morning.

Waves

Issued 06:00 PM NDT 17 April 2024
Tonight and Thursday. Seas 1 to 2 metres building to 2 to 3 early Thursday morning and to 4 to 6 near noon Thursday.

Iceberg Limit

Iceberg limit at 0000 UTC 18 Apr estimated from Newfoundland near
4729N 5245W to 4805N 4945W to 5155N 4720W to 5445N 4940W to 5625N
4830W to 5800N 4525W then eastwards.

Western iceberg limit at 0000 UTC 18 Apr estimated from Quebec near
5016N 6031W to Newfoundland near 4920N 5750W.

Iceberg Count

No confirmed icebergs except less than 10 icebergs north of the
iceberg limit.

Marine Weather Statement

Issued 2:52 AM NDT 18 April 2024 A low pressure system over the Southeastern Grand Banks will
retrograde towards the Avalon Peninsula today before moving eastwards
out to sea on Friday. Strong to gale force northeast to
northwesterlies can be expected to the north and west of the low.

Marine interests are advised that gale warnings are in effect for all
waters except Strait of Belle Isle - western half, Gulf waters, and
the Southern Grand Banks.
